On 20 December 2021, an eruption began on Hunga TongaHunga Ha'apai, a submarine volcano in the Tongan archipelago in the southern Pacific Ocean.The eruption reached a very large and powerful climax nearly four weeks later, on 15 January 2022. On Jan. 15, 2022, a powerful explosive eruption from the underwater volcano Hunga Tonga Hunga Ha-apai lofted volcanic ash and gas high into the stratosphere and sent atmospheric shockwaves and tsunami waves around the world.
